DMT1 blocker 2 (2-pyridin-2-yl-4,5-dihydro-3H-benzo[e]indazol-1-one) is a small-molecule research compound that directly inhibits divalent metal transporter 1 (DMT1) with an in vitro IC50 of 0.83 μM. It blocks iron uptake by enterocytes in vivo and is supplied as a high-purity solid suitable for biochemical and cellular studies.
- Direct DMT1 inhibitor, IC50 = 0.83 μM.
- High purity (99.9%).
- Molecular formula C16H13N3O; molecular weight 263.29 g/mol.
- Soluble in DMSO for stock solution preparation.
- Suitable for biochemical assays and cellular studies of iron transport.
